Minify

speak

Minify refers to the process of reducing the size of a file, typically a HTML, CSS, or JavaScript file, while preserving its functionality. Minification usually involves removing unnecessary characters, such as whitespace, comments, and certain symbols, to make the file as small as possible. This is often done to improve the load time and performance of a website or web application, as smaller files can be loaded faster and use less bandwidth. Minification is often performed by software tools, such as minifiers, and can also be done manually by editing the file.
